SCKLM : When Seeing Is Believing

June 28, 2009 ladynina 1 comment

My Half Marathon finisher medal...  =)

My Half Marathon finisher medal... =)

Completed my SCKLM 21KM today with a great feeling. A shy of 9KM from my 30KM in January, early this year and yet it was still torturous for me. Being an amateur marathoner, that’s why. Hee. Technically, I ran myself as most of my friends were in a different league. So, self-pscyho myself seemed to work for a time like this. And definitely my favourite line for today is Run Like The Wind. Hee. So for 2 hours or so, I let it be played on repetition in my mind, like an old broken record; “Don’t stop… run like the wind…” Hey, it worked real fine !

Pre-Race Day

I collected my race pack on Day 1 and word couldn’t describe how unorganised was the logistic for the collection. Weather was not on our side (can’t blame the organiser for this), but I blamed them for not having extra tents, should thing like this happen. Ended up, people ran from the field to the organiser tents for shelter. Messy. Very messy! When the rain stopped, power was off and we had to wait quite sometime for the power to be back because system was down that time. After I collected everything, 2 of the packs I collected on behalf of friends had no running bib and I need to queue one more time at the information tent to ask for the bibs. Apparently, I wasn’t the only one. A lot of other marathoners didn’t have the running bib in their race pack. It was like one after another. But good thing was, they managed to resolve these hiccups on Day 2. So people who collected the race pack on Day 2 had a better experience than us.

Race Day

Reached Dataran Merdeka as early as 5.15 am and it was drizzled on my way there by foot. Most of the half marathoners were on the field by the time I reached the place. Our flagged off was on time as expected. I considered myself as lucky because I didn’t face any hiccup on the race day itself. As in, there were enough water/isotonic/sponge stations for me. I’m not sure for those who came later than me. I heard some water stations were not there by the time they reached the designated marks. On a side note, frequently my friends ask me why do I sign up for so many runs. To me, the one thing or shall I say the main reason is, I love to see the will power showed by the runners, regardless of what age. It is a beautiful sight to see. So… I did see a lot of them along the way and I was amazed on how a strong mind outwits anything.

On my route thing, since I ’studied’ the route before hand, I basically could estimate how long more I need to run. The moment I saw Sogo turn for half marathoners, I sprinted like nobody business. Managed to finish my run way before time and I’m happy with my timing. Yayy !

My dislike in this marathon was the crowd control at the finishing line. It looked like a carnival where those who had done their deed, scattered around the finishing line and it was a bit distracted for me. In fact there was a couple who walked and talked in front of me and I had to cut them off. All I need was just a smooth finishing after the 21KM route. And another hiccup was I didn’t know what to do next after I crossed the finishing line. No one told me what to do or where to go next. I had to called MC, asked her what to do. But of couse she was on the way back already. Gee… I hope the next SCKLM will be much better than this.

All and all, the route was tough and the hilly part was quite long. Thank goodness the weather was so nice that it helped me a lot. I reckon that I was so lucky that I didn’t face any hiccup on my side; be it before the run or on the run day itself. I pity those runners who suffered lack of water stations and some of 5KM runners were misdirected and ended up they ran for lesser than 5KM and some even finished within 10 minutes. So many drama it seemed but well, people say, if they didn’t happen, they won’t learn. Hope the next organiser will do much better job. So overall, that was a great experience. Definitely not my last SCKLM. Hopefully.

Cheers to all of us SCKL marathoners !!! mysignatureSee y’all next time.
